Ashton Kutcher's 30th Birthday Bash Require Hepa-A Vaccination

February 22, 2008 7:44 a.m. EST

Anne Lu - Celebrity News Service News Writer

New York, NY (CNS) - Ashton Kutcher has celebrated his 30th birthday with a Hepa-A food scare.

The former Punk'd host and the partygoers for his birthday have been urged by the New York City Department of Health to get vaccinated as a precaution for possible Hepatitis A contact when he celebrated the event at Socialista in West Village on February 7.

The agency informed the hotspot's management that their bartender, who worked on February 7, 8 and 11, was infected with the disease. The employee could possibly have transferred Hepa-A to the customers dining during those three nights, which the owners estimate to have nearly 800 people present.

"Although no additional cases of illness have been identified, the New York City Department of Health is urging customers to get the vaccination as a precautionary measure," a statement released by Socialista says. "We are grateful for their efforts and we will continue to support them in every way possible."

Kutcher was accompanied by his wife, Demi Moore on the occasion. Other party guests include Bruce Willis, Madonna, Gwenyth Paltrow, Molly Sims, Ali Larter, Liv Tyler, Salma Hayek, Lucy Liu, Lake Bell, and Ivanka Trump among others.
